Transaction 174c628c87e0f42254834b68a7038375a12fa34c36e4087a5d5bf4c4ced12fe5
1 Input
1 Output
-
174c628c87e0f42254834b68a7038375a12fa34c36e4087a5d5bf4c4ced12fe5:0
- value
- 7117923
- script pubkey
- OP_0 OP_PUSHBYTES_20 6404057ef3e85c9a0e059d8ca42e967ed98b9c40
- address
- bc1qvszq2lhnapwf5rs9nkx2gt5k0mvch8zqsfy5cj